示例2
def getAllTitles():
"""Returns a list of strings of window titles for all visible windows.
"""
# Source: https://stackoverflow.com/questions/53237278/obtain-list-of-all-window-titles-on-macos-from-a-python-script/53985082#53985082
windows = Quartz.CGWindowListCopyWindowInfo(Quartz.kCGWindowListExcludeDesktopElements | Quartz.kCGWindowListOptionOnScreenOnly, Quartz.kCGNullWindowID)
return ['%s %s' % (win[Quartz.kCGWindowOwnerName], win.get(Quartz.kCGWindowName, '')) for win in windows]
示例3
def getActiveWindow():
"""Returns a Window object of the currently active Window."""
# Source: https://stackoverflow.com/questions/5286274/front-most-window-using-cgwindowlistcopywindowinfo
windows = Quartz.CGWindowListCopyWindowInfo(Quartz.kCGWindowListExcludeDesktopElements | Quartz.kCGWindowListOptionOnScreenOnly, Quartz.kCGNullWindowID)
for win in windows:
if win['kCGWindowLayer'] == 0:
return '%s %s' % (win[Quartz.kCGWindowOwnerName], win.get(Quartz.kCGWindowName, '')) # Temporary. For now, we'll just return the title of the active window.
raise Exception('Could not find an active window.') # Temporary hack.

示例8
def get_screen_pixel(x, y):
image = CG.CGWindowListCreateImage(
CoreGraphics.CGRectMake(x, y, 2, 2),
CG.kCGWindowListOptionOnScreenOnly,
CG.kCGNullWindowID,
CG.kCGWindowImageDefault)
bytes = CG.CGDataProviderCopyData(CG.CGImageGetDataProvider(image))
b, g, r, a = struct.unpack_from("BBBB", bytes, offset=0)
return (r, g, b, a)
